Just FYI, if that is a 78-79 frotnt 44 then the wedges can not be cut off.

78-79 wedges are cast and there is no axle tube underneath them.

i was referring to grinding the "C" blocks down (hence the patience), then using the base for a mounting place for a 4-link.
i used several cut-off wheels, 2 grinding wheels, & a flapper wheel to get mine smoothed out enough.
